Best answer to the question «What are litter box liners for cats?»

Litter box liners are plastic bags that line your cats litter box. The liner goes over the empty litter box before the litter goes in the box. The litter then goes on top of the liner.

Can cats tear up litter box liners?
Cats with long sharp nails can tear flimsy liners if they vigorously scratch the bottom of the box Both types of liners are available from a variety of manufacturers. You can buy litter box liners or you can make your own.
How do you use a 30 layer litter box?
To use these liners, you place all 30 layers in a clean empty litter box securing the sides of the bags to the box. You place the litter on top of the liners. When the box is dirty, you remove the top liner only and allow the clean litter to sift through the bag onto the clean liners.

Do cats like litter box liners or lids?
Most cats don’t like box liners or lids on their boxes. Cats like their litter boxes located in a quiet but not “cornered” location. They like to be able to see people or other animals approaching, and they like to have multiple escape routes in case they want to leave their boxes quickly.

What do cats like in their litter boxes?
Most cats like a shallow bed of litter. Provide one to two inches of litter rather than three to four inches. Most cats prefer clumping, unscented litter. Your cat may prefer the type of litter she used as a kitten. Most cats don’t like box liners or lids on their boxes. Cats like their litter boxes located in a quiet but not “cornered” location.

Why does my cat tear up the litter box liner?
  • a) Boredom. Cats have a natural instinct to exercise and sharpen their claws by scratching any object they’re able to scratch.
  • b) They Hate the Sound It Makes. Most litter box liners are made of plastic which may create a rustling or crumping sound when the cat steps on it.
